Mike writes:

> I'd like a little re-assurance I'm doing the right thing here.  
> I'm
> about to get my '93 5 spoke 16x8's refinished.  Before I do, any
> opinions about the relative performance of a high-end low profile 
> tire
> in a 16" size vs. a 17" or 18" tire?  I doubt it's that big of a
> difference, certainly not enough to warrant switching to bigger 
> wheels
> considering the roads I have to drive on around here (NH).

I ran a set of 245/45 16" Toyo TS-1s on the 16x8 wheels. Then I 
switched to the same tire in a 255/40 17" size on a set of 17x8 
wheels.

Yes, there's a difference. The 16" wheels gave a bit of a fat, 
floaty ride in comparison to the 17"s. Not bad, per se...but the 
17"s were clearly superior. The Toyos ride great, so there was 
little to no degradation in ride quality, but the handling got 
better.

Better enough that the soft rear became obvious and I had to 
install the HSRB. That solved the rear problem.

This was on a car with Eibachs and Bilsteins, btw.

Oh, and also, your 16x8" wheels are too wide for snow tire use, 
particularly in NH. you want a 16x7 wheel with 205/55 16" snow 
tires. Anything wider and your snow traction will go downhill.
